Job Description

As a Utility Surveyor, using your technical expertise, you will deliver a first-class service to our customers with safety being paramount. Your role will be to identify, evaluate, and quantify work required to maintain contract specification safety clearances from overhead electrical networks.

This role is within our arboriculture and infrastructure vegetation management division, known for safe and efficient delivery of services across the Midlands and South East, from our Ledbury and Hermitage offices, working on strategic, long-term contracts.

Key Responsibilities
  1. Understand relevant industry legislation and safety guidelines related to arboricultural work.
  2. Conduct site-specific risk assessments and implement robust emergency procedures.
  3. Prepare work packs aligned with contract specifications for operational arborists.
  4. Liaise with private landowners and stakeholders to obtain necessary consents.
  5. Identify and understand safety zones and their inherent dangers.
  6. Ensure safety for yourself and others on site.
  7. Coach and mentor junior team members.
  8. Coordinate with the wider delivery team to track and complete work per client requirements.
  9. Work autonomously with a focus on delivering high-quality, professional service.
Experience and Qualifications
  • Minimum of 2 years' arboriculture experience.
  • Hold UA1, UA2.1, and UA5 certifications.
